WebPolymer viscosity is affected by water salinity and divalent ions such as calcium (Ca 2+) and magnesium (Mg 2+ ), which decrease the viscosity of the polymer solution. As the salinity … WebOnly polymers with isoviscose behavior will obey the WLF equation. For all other polymers, the two parameters might be very different. Many polymers have melt viscosities of about 10 13 poise at their glass transition temperature. This E * represents the temperature coefficient of viscosity for the Newtonian region which is also equal to the value measured at constant … fish bcr abl questWebEffect of pH on Viscosity Carbopol® and Pemulen™ polymers must be neutralized in order to achieve maximum viscosity. Unneutralized dispersions have an approximate pH range of 2.5-3.5 depending on the polymer concentration.
